nutriment
  فاراک  
fârâk
Fr.: nourriture  
  1. Any substance or matter that, taken into a living organism, serves to sustain it in its existence, promoting growth, replacing loss, and providing energy.

  2. Anything that nourishes; nourishment; food (Dictionary.com).

Etymology (EN): From L. nutrimentum “nourishment; support,” from nutrire, → nourish.

Etymology (PE): Fârâk, from present stem of fâridan, → nourish,

  • -âk (as in xorâk, pušâk, etc.).
